public class MongoDBConfiguration extends DocumentStoreConfiguration
MongoDBDatastoreProvider.| Modifier and Type | Field and Description |
|---|---|
static String |
DEFAULT_ASSOCIATION_STORE |
| Constructor and Description |
|---|
MongoDBConfiguration(ConfigurationPropertyReader propertyReader,
OptionsContext globalOptions)
Creates a new
MongoDBConfiguration. |
| Modifier and Type | Method and Description |
|---|---|
List<com.mongodb.MongoCredential> |
buildCredentials() |
com.mongodb.MongoClientOptions |
buildOptions()
Create a
MongoClientOptions using the MongoDBConfiguration. |
getDatabaseName, getHosts, getPassword, getUsername, isCreateDatabasepublic static final String DEFAULT_ASSOCIATION_STORE
public MongoDBConfiguration(ConfigurationPropertyReader propertyReader, OptionsContext globalOptions)
MongoDBConfiguration.propertyReader - provides access to configuration values given via persistence.xml etc.globalOptions - global settings given via an option configuratorpublic com.mongodb.MongoClientOptions buildOptions()
MongoClientOptions using the MongoDBConfiguration.MongoClientOptions corresponding to the MongoDBConfigurationpublic List<com.mongodb.MongoCredential> buildCredentials()
Copyright © 2010–2016 Hibernate. All rights reserved.